Question: Refer to the transactions in E6-9.
Required: Prepare the transactions for GameGirl, Inc., assuming the company uses a perpetual inventory system. Assume the 50 game devices sold on August 6 to DS Unlimited had a cost to GameGirl of $80 each. The items returned on August 10 were considered worthless to GameGirl and were discarded.
E6-9: DS Unlimited has the following transactions during August.
August 6 Purchases 50 handheld game devices on account from GameGirl, Inc., for $100 each, terms 1/10, n/60.
August 7 Pays $300 to Sure Shipping for freight charges associated with the August 6 purchase.
August 10 Returns to GameGirl five game devices that were defective.
August 14 Pays the full amount due to GameGirl.
August 23 Sells 30 game devices purchased on August 6 for $120 each to customers on account. The total cost of the 30 game devices sold is $3,170.
Required: Record the transactions of DS Unlimited, assuming the company uses a perpetual inventory system.
